LED candelabra bulbs come in various types, each designed for specific applications and aesthetics. Below is a comparison table of different types of LED candelabra bulbs:

Type Description Best Use
Standard Candelabra E12 base, traditional shape Chandeliers, sconces
Flame Tip Flame-shaped design Decorative lighting
Dimmable Adjustable brightness Mood lighting
Vintage Edison Retro design with visible filaments Vintage-style fixtures
Smart LED Wi-Fi enabled for remote control Smart homes

  1. Energy Efficiency: LED candelabra bulbs consume significantly less energy compared to incandescent bulbs. This not only reduces electricity bills but also contributes to a lower carbon footprint.

  2. Longevity: With lifespans reaching up to 50,000 hours, LED candelabra bulbs outlast traditional bulbs by a significant margin. This means fewer replacements and less waste.

  3. Versatility: These bulbs are available in various shapes and sizes, making them suitable for a wide range of fixtures, from chandeliers to wall sconces.

  4. Color Temperature Options: LED candelabra bulbs offer a variety of color temperatures, allowing users to choose the ambiance they desire. Warmer tones create a cozy atmosphere, while cooler tones are ideal for task lighting.

  5. Dimming Capabilities: Many LED candelabra bulbs are dimmable, providing flexibility in lighting design. This feature is particularly useful in settings where mood lighting is essential.

  6. Smart Technology: Some LED candelabra bulbs come equipped with smart technology, allowing users to control lighting remotely via smartphones or voice commands.

Differences Between LED and Incandescent Bulbs

The transition from incandescent to LED lighting has been significant in recent years. Here are some key differences:
Energy Consumption: LED bulbs use a fraction of the energy that incandescent bulbs do, making them more cost-effective in the long run.
Heat Emission: LED bulbs emit very little heat compared to incandescent bulbs, which can get extremely hot and pose a fire risk.
